The TRB Transit Innovations Deserving Exploratory Analysis (IDEA) Program's Connected and Automated Parking Feasibility – A Pilot Study is the first pilot study in the United States to test the benefits transit agencies may obtain from deploying automated parking technology.


    Augmented Reality Dispatcher Interface
    5/28/2021 12:00:11 PM
    Train dispatchers could use Augmented Reality (AR) to view their current displays in 3D. Such an interface would allow dispatchers to use hand and head movements, along with voice commands, to manage the same things that they do currently on their multi-monitor displays, such as track diagrams, alarms, train and station information, and setting of train movements.     Evaluation of an Automatic, Individual Computer-Based Driver Education and Training Program
    4/12/2021 9:47:36 AM
    Safety technologies and programs aimed at reducing or eliminating risky driving behaviors may prevent a large number of crashes. The TRB IDEA (Innovations Deserving Exploratory Analysis) Program's Transit IDEA Final Report 88: Evaluation of an Automatic, Individual Computer-Based Driver Education and Training Program analyzes a software program that uses onboard safety monitoring data to monitor driver behavior and automatically assign relevant, individualized online driver training as needed.

    Development of a Mass-Based Automated Passenger Counter
    1/25/2020 12:56:55 PM
    Automatic passenger counters (APCs) provide passenger boarding and alighting information associated with time and location data. They are a standard tool used by many transit authorities to measure and report monthly ridership to the National Transportation Database, with resulting federal subsidies calculated solely based on the data they provide.
